Unfinished wood pull 96mm center to center describes this Belwith Keeler Natural Woodcraft Series handle, so you get a sized cabinet pull ready for layout on 96 mm boring patterns. The 3-3/4 inch center to center dimension matches common cabinet and drawer drilling, which helps align this pull with existing holes on many casework runs. The wood material gives you a natural substrate that accepts stains or clear coats, so you can match other wood components in your project. The unfinished wood finish arrives bare, which lets you apply a finishing system that fits your shop schedule and cabinet color program. A 4-3/8 inch overall length provides enough grip span for fingers, while staying compact for smaller fronts. The 7/8 inch projection sets the hand away from the face by a modest distance, which reduces snag risk on tight walkways while still offering usable clearance.
